What makes Urdu romantic fiction particularly compelling is its ability to ground high emotions in everyday realities. Many contemporary novels are "socio-romantic," meaning they explore love not in a vacuum, but within the intricate web of family expectations, social issues, cultural traditions, and personal struggles. These stories resonate deeply because the love between characters is tested by circumstances their readers recognize firsthand—forbidden glances across a crowded courtyard, the quiet rebellion of choosing one's own partner, or the triumph of devotion over seemingly insurmountable odds.

In the scholarly context, is considered the first romantic fiction writer of Urdu fiction, paving the way for many others who joined the movement, including Qazi Abdul Ghaffar, Niaz Fateh Poori, Manoon Gorakh poori, and Khaliqi Dehelvi. The stage was set by Rashid-ul-khairi who wrote the first Urdu short story, "Naseer aour Khadija," marking the beginning of this rich tradition. urdu font sex stories extra quality

Urdu romantic literature is characterized by its intensity, emotional depth, and often, the dramatic tension between love and societal norms.
